How Much Does a 100kW Photovoltaic Energy Storage System Cost?

Understanding the Investment in Solar Storage Solutions

If you're exploring 100kW photovoltaic energy storage costs, you're likely planning a commercial or industrial-scale project. Prices typically range between $80,000 and $150,000 USD, but let's dig deeper into what shapes this investment. Think of it like buying a car – the final price depends on the "engine" (battery type), "fuel efficiency" (system lifespan), and "optional features" (smart controls).

Key Cost Components of a 100kW System

  • Battery Bank (50-60% of total cost): Lithium-ion vs. lead-acid options
  • Inverters (20-25%): Hybrid models for solar+storage integration
  • Balance of System (15-20%): Wiring, monitoring, safety equipment
  • Installation (10-18%): Varies by roof type and local regulations

Real-World Cost Breakdown by Region

Region Average Cost (USD) Key Influencers
North America $120,000-$145,000 UL certifications, labor costs
Europe €105,000-€130,000 CE compliance, VAT rates
Southeast Asia $85,000-$110,000 Local manufacturing incentives

Emerging Trends Impacting Prices

The industry's shift toward modular battery designs allows easier capacity upgrades – imagine adding storage "blocks" as your business grows. Recent data shows a 22% year-over-year decrease in lithium iron phosphate (LFP) battery prices, making them the new darling of commercial installations.

Case Study: Factory Energy Transformation

A manufacturing plant in Spain achieved 73% grid independence through:

  1. 100kW solar array with bi-directional inverter
  2. 200kWh liquid-cooled battery storage
  3. AI-powered load management system

Their $138,000 investment delivers $28,000 annual savings – that's a 4.9-year payback period!

FAQ: Solar Storage Costs Demystified

What's the typical system lifespan?

Modern lithium systems last 12-15 years with proper maintenance. Many manufacturers offer 10-year performance guarantees.

How does climate affect costs?

Hot climates may require 15-20% larger battery banks due to reduced efficiency at high temperatures.
